Tokyo-Osaka Airline Shuttle Posts 15% Passenger Gain
Officials of Japan's three major carries, Japan Airlines, All Nippon Airways and Japan Air System are surprised by unexpectedly favorable results in the first year of joint shuttle service between Tokyo and Osaka.
